Meghan Powell enters her first season with the Cowgirl soccer program. She comes to Laramie following a three-year stint at Colorado School of Mines.
Powell was the head athletic trainer for the Orediggers, working with football, both men’s and women’s soccer, cross-country, track & field, wrestling and softball. Prior to ascending to the head role, Powell was the assistant athletic trainer in Golden for four years.
Prior to her time at Colorado School of Mines, Powell worked Fort Lewis College in numerous different positions. She was the interim head athletic trainer for one season -- working with football, women’s soccer, softball, cross-country and track. She was also the associate head athletic trainer for one season and held an assistant athletic trainer role for five seasons.
Before her time in Durango, Powell interned at Abilene Christian for one season, working with cross-country and track & field. Prior to that, she was the head athletic trainer at Westmont High School for two years.
Powell earned her bachelor’s degree in exercise science - athletic training at Fort Lewis and earned a master’s degree in kinesiology - athletic training at San Jose State.
